首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在不删除逗号的情况下将数据帧写入csv

在不删除逗号的情况下将数据帧写入CSV文件,可以使用Python中的pandas库来实现。pandas是一个强大的数据分析工具,可以方便地处理和操作数据。

首先,我们需要将数据帧保存为CSV文件。可以使用pandas中的to_csv()函数来实现。该函数可以将数据帧保存为CSV格式的文件,并且可以指定文件路径和文件名。

下面是一个示例代码:

代码语言:txt
复制
import pandas as pd

# 创建一个数据帧
data = {'Name': ['Alice', 'Bob', 'Charlie'],
        'Age': [25, 30, 35],
        'City': ['New York', 'London', 'Paris']}
df = pd.DataFrame(data)

# 将数据帧保存为CSV文件
df.to_csv('data.csv', index=False)

在上面的代码中,我们首先创建了一个包含姓名、年龄和城市的数据帧。然后,使用to_csv()函数将数据帧保存为名为"data.csv"的CSV文件。参数index=False表示不保存行索引。

如果数据帧中的某些列包含逗号,我们可以在保存CSV文件时指定适当的参数来处理。例如,可以使用quotechar参数指定一个不常用的字符作为引号字符,以避免与逗号冲突。

下面是一个示例代码:

代码语言:txt
复制
import pandas as pd

# 创建一个包含逗号的数据帧
data = {'Name': ['Alice', 'Bob', 'Charlie'],
        'Description': ['Hello, world!', 'Nice to meet you.', 'How are you, today?']}
df = pd.DataFrame(data)

# 将数据帧保存为CSV文件,指定引号字符为@
df.to_csv('data.csv', index=False, quotechar='@')

在上面的代码中,我们创建了一个包含逗号的数据帧,其中描述列包含逗号。然后,使用to_csv()函数将数据帧保存为CSV文件,并指定引号字符为"@"。这样,保存的CSV文件中的逗号将被引号包围,避免与数据中的逗号冲突。

总结起来,使用pandas库的to_csv()函数可以方便地将数据帧写入CSV文件,而通过指定适当的参数,可以处理包含逗号的数据列,避免冲突。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

1分23秒

3403+2110方案全黑场景测试_最低照度无限接近于0_20230731

4分49秒

089.sync.Map的Load相关方法

25分35秒

新知:第四期 腾讯明眸画质增强-数据驱动下的AI媒体处理

14分30秒

Percona pt-archiver重构版--大表数据归档工具

3分23秒

《中国数据库前世今生:回顾与展望》

2.1K
37秒

智能振弦传感器介绍

5分33秒

JSP 在线学习系统myeclipse开发mysql数据库web结构java编程

领券